Manuscript, Taj (Keter Torah) of Vayikra-Devarim, Torah with Targum Onkelos and Tafsir of Rabbi Se'adya Gaon. On the margins are the Ba'al HaTurim commentary and Mesorah notes. [Yemen, c. 18th century].
Particularly beautiful writing. Nikud tachton and nikud elyon. First and last leaves were replaced at a later time. On last page: "Peticha L'Tinokim…".
[6], 5-241, [4] leaves. Approximately 28 cm. Fair condition. Major wear and stains, worming and mildew. Several leaves with tears affecting text. Folk binding, with leather spine.
